Output 3d3299b1cd83be58787e126552cffe6817a05dc821357af7c51fa01c845912a3:18

value
368004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3384580b2d2c93dd2c59a75df197987be5638cae OP_EQUALVERIFY OP_CHECKSIG
address
15hQ1CcL2PDENQgffjRMNDMqFVwUqaGwYq
transaction
3d3299b1cd83be58787e126552cffe6817a05dc821357af7c51fa01c845912a3
spent
true